LOS ANGELES, Oct. 1 (UPI) -- Hollywood actress Drew Barrymore confirmed Monday she gave birth to her first child, a daughter named Olive, last week.

"We are proud to announce the birth of our daughter, Olive Barrymore Kopelman, born Sept. 26, healthy, happy and welcomed by the whole family," the actress and her husband, art consultant Will Kopelman, told People.com in a statement. "Thank you for respecting our privacy during this most special time in our lives."

No other details regarding the child's birth were immediately released.

Barrymore and Kopelman married in June.
